aboutsummaryrefslogtreecommitdiff
path: root/paludis/repositories/e/eapi.hh
diff options
context:
space:
mode:
authorAvatar David Leverton <levertond@googlemail.com> 2011-04-01 22:09:46 +0100
committerAvatar David Leverton <levertond@googlemail.com> 2011-04-02 01:02:05 +0100
commit568b21f7bec6a17356bedfbc95a6adf505d74d59 (patch)
treeca155acb9e7a69c1019d2f977a8d098fc445eba9 /paludis/repositories/e/eapi.hh
parentea370e26e5bd368512c7e54f11f5179ac4fe1610 (diff)
downloadpaludis-568b21f7bec6a17356bedfbc95a6adf505d74d59.tar.gz
paludis-568b21f7bec6a17356bedfbc95a6adf505d74d59.tar.xz
Make --use-with / --use-enable with empty 3rd argument EAPI-dependent
See: Gentoo#322049
Diffstat (limited to 'paludis/repositories/e/eapi.hh')
-rw-r--r--paludis/repositories/e/eapi.hh2
1 files changed, 2 insertions, 0 deletions
diff --git a/paludis/repositories/e/eapi.hh b/paludis/repositories/e/eapi.hh
index 50d601abb..e9c8745b0 100644
--- a/paludis/repositories/e/eapi.hh
+++ b/paludis/repositories/e/eapi.hh
@@ -208,6 +208,7 @@ namespace paludis
typedef Name<struct name_use_expand> use_expand;
typedef Name<struct name_use_expand_hidden> use_expand_hidden;
typedef Name<struct name_use_expand_separator> use_expand_separator;
+ typedef Name<struct name_use_with_enable_empty_third_argument> use_with_enable_empty_third_argument;
typedef Name<struct name_userpriv_cannot_use_root> userpriv_cannot_use_root;
typedef Name<struct name_utility_path_suffixes> utility_path_suffixes;
typedef Name<struct name_vdb_from_env_unless_empty_variables> vdb_from_env_unless_empty_variables;
@@ -467,6 +468,7 @@ namespace paludis
NamedValue<n::unpack_fix_permissions, bool> unpack_fix_permissions;
NamedValue<n::unpack_suffixes, std::string> unpack_suffixes;
NamedValue<n::unpack_unrecognised_is_fatal, bool> unpack_unrecognised_is_fatal;
+ NamedValue<n::use_with_enable_empty_third_argument, bool> use_with_enable_empty_third_argument;
};
struct EAPIPipeCommands